A missing person is a person who has disappeared and whose status as alive or dead cannot be confirmed as their location and condition are unknown. A person may go missing through a voluntary disappearance, or else due to an accident, crime, death in a location where they cannot be found (such as at sea), or many other reasons. In most parts of the world, a missing person will usually be found quickly. While criminal abductions are some of the most widely reported missing person cases, these account for only 2 to 5 percent of missing children in Europe. By contrast, some missing person cases remain unresolved for many years. Laws related to these cases are often complex since, in many jurisdictions, relatives and third parties may not deal with a person's assets until their death is considered proven by law and a formal death certificate issued. The situation, uncertainties, and lack of closure or a funeral resulting when a person goes missing may be extremely painful with long-lasting effects on family and friends. A number of organizations seek to connect, share best practices, and disseminate information and images of missing children to improve the effectiveness of missing children investigations, including the International Commission on Missing Persons, the International Centre for Missing & Exploited Children (ICMEC), as well as national organizations, including the National Center for Missing & Exploited Children in the US, Missing People in the UK, Child Focus in Belgium, and The Smile of the Child in Greece.

Avis Beatrice Harris Mooney

Mooney, date, approximate 1961; Age-progression to an unknown age
Date Missing 09/01/1961
Missing From
Mabank, Texas
Missing Classification Endangered Missing
Sex Female
Race
White
Date of Birth 10/26/1927 (94)
Age 33 - 34 years old
Height and Weight 5'3, 140 pounds
Medical Conditions Mooney may have been suffering from an undiagnosed mental condition, possibly bipolar disorder, at the time of her disappearance.
Markings and/or Distinguishing Characteristics Caucasian female. Dark brown hair, dark brown eyes. Mooney has a fair, freckled complexion. She may have hysterectomy and/or appendectomy scars on her abdomen, and she has a dark brown, quarter-sized birthmark on her hip. Some agencies refer to Mooney as Avis Beatrice Mooney.
Details of Disappearance Mooney was last seen in Mabank, Texas sometime during the autumn months of 1961. Her husband told their two children that he had come home and found a note from her, saying she was leaving him.
They had been having many marital problems and fought frequently, sometimes physically, and Mooney had left her husband before, so her family did not question her husband's story at first.
Mooney's family has not heard from her since around the time she disappeared, when her mother got a letter from her. Her mother is not sure Mooney actually wrote the letter, however; she thinks the handwriting resembles her son-in-law's more than her daughter's.
There was a possible sighting of Mooney in Hughes Springs, Texas in the early 1970s, but this has not been confirmed. Her remains unsolved. Foul play is possible in her disappearance.
